Some laboratory processes involve automated analysis combined with manual review by technologists. For example, when hematology analysers flag samples as abnormal, automated white blood cell differential counts may be superseded by manual differential counts using stained slides read at the microscope or scanned by digital imaging software.

Another way to diagnose BV that is less often used in a clinical setting is a Nugent score. To obtain a Nugent score, gram stain techniques are carried out and it characterizes the bacterial morphology on a scale. A score greater than 7 is associated with BV, 4-6 is an intermediate abnormality, and 0-3 is normal. [42]

In Berlin, in 1884, Gram developed a method for distinguishing between two major classes of bacteria. [1] This technique, known as Gram staining, continues to be a standard procedure of medical microbiology. This work gained Gram an international reputation.
